Are you going to provide advance notification to your sponsors and/or other organizations, in
addition to the affected vendors?
No, oCERT won't reveal any non-public information to whatever organization (including sponsors), except
to the specific people who are actually involved in oCERT operations (i.e. team members).
Details can be found in the membership page.

I am an individual working in the security field and I'm interested in oCERT, can I join?
Membership to oCERT is open to projects or organizations that develop and
publish Open Source code, it is not meant for individual researchers and/or supporters. If you want to help out
oCERT you are welcome to submit incidents or vulnerabilities reports if you'd like your research findings to be routed through us. Our mailing list is also a good way for keeping up to date with our project activity. Additionally we recommend joining the oss security mailing list.
